Can You Bring Your Own Drinks On Royal Caribbean. For consecutive sailings, guests of drinking age are allowed to bring one (1) 750 ml bottle of wine or champagne for each individual sailing. However, it’s important to note that the beverages must be in sealed, original packaging. Your cruise fare includes tap water, hot teas, coffee, iced tea, lemonade, hot chocolate, and fruit juices.
